Transaction 7a8aeaddecaf81a4de6f40e3e7638b99f6cafd95d7eabb7f359d7bb7601f6211
1 Input
1 Output
-
7a8aeaddecaf81a4de6f40e3e7638b99f6cafd95d7eabb7f359d7bb7601f6211:0
- value
- 2900542
- script pubkey
- OP_0 OP_PUSHBYTES_20 6dbfacc271e5a792b2267a1973439ba5b0909291
- address
- bc1qdkl6esn3ukne9v3x0gvhxsum5kcfpy53zlauz8